pub struct TextureButton { /* fields omitted */ }
core class TextureButton : BaseButton
(manually managed)
Base class
TextureButton inherits BaseButton and all of its methods.
Memory management
Non reference counted objects such as the ones of this type are usually owned by the engine.
In the cases where Rust code owns an object of this type, ownership should be either passed
to the engine or the object must be manually destroyed using TextureButton::free
.

pub fn new() -> Self
[src]
Constructor.
Because this type is not reference counted, the lifetime of the returned object
is not automatically managed.
Immediately after creation, the object is owned by the caller, and can be
passed to the engine (in which case the engine will be responsible for
destroying the object) or destroyed manually using TextureButton::free
.
pub unsafe fn free(self)
[src]
Manually deallocate the object.
